The Montreux Jazz Festival takes place for two weeks every summer in Switzerland, on the shores of Lake Geneva. Created in 1967 by Claude Nobs, the Festival has become over the years an essential event, generating fantastic stories and legendary performances. Nearly 250,000 spectators come every year, enjoying a breathtaking setting and concerts with renowned acoustics.
While jazz, soul and blues are at the roots of this event, other music genres found their place early on, including many electro, house and techno acts. In addition to the main concerts, over 250 DJ sets are free to attend each summer in picturesque venues, including a nightclub built on the lake

Cerrone
Celebrating 50 years of musical career, French disco icon Marc Cerrone has shaped the sound of today’s disco-fuelled pop music from Dua Lipa to Mark Ronson. His first hit “Love in C Minor” earned him 6 Billboard Awards including Artist of the year, sold +3M copies and ranked 3rd in worldwide charts for months. After multiple platinum albums, production work, collaborations with artists such as Purple Disco Machine, and projects across the globe, Cerrone pursues the progress of disco.
